with more than seven hundred companies - from large world leaders multinationals to small and medium family businesses- covering the entire value chain, from components and wind turbine manufacturing, engineering and consulting companies to those that provide all services to the farms already in operation. The value chain of the wind energy industry can be divided into four big subsectors: Wind farm developers /energy producers, Wind turbine manufacturers, Specific components manufacturers (bearings, gear boxes) Other attached services to all phases (engineering and consulting, finance, technological solutions). Value Chain of Wind Energy

The development of wind energy in Spain is regarded as a model due tomany different circumstances; one of them is the fact that the installed capacity at the beginning of 2011 of 20,676 MW is only exceeded by three countries: China, United States and Germany, of much larger population and area. New 1,515.95 MW were installed in 2010, which were the highest increase across the European Union. This development has been steady and regular over the last twelve years thanks to the firm commitment made during the last two decades both by the Government and by a large business sector. The fact that wind power covered 16.6 percent of the electricity demand in 2010 becomes very important to our country as it is practically an electrical island with a very low interconnection level. The effort made by the industry, along with the System Operator to integrate into the grid overcoming some sensitive issues such as the adaptation of the turbines to voltage dips, and achieving that high level of penetration has no comparison in the world and has become a reference. But, undoubtedly, the most important feature is that the development of wind energy in Spain has been accompanied by the creation of a solid industrial base

Other values, like having its own technology, a continuous and big effort in R&D -well above the average of the energy sector as a whole- , and, finally, the high qualification of its workers, must be added to the importance of the business value chain and its quantitative assessment. Indeed, according to the latest edition of the Macroeconomic Study of the Impact of the Wind Energy Sector in Spain, published in November 2010, one of the keys to the success of the Spanish model is the level of recognized industry professionals worldwide. This study highlights the industrial base built around wind energy in Spain which employed (directly and indirectly) 35,719 people by the end of 2009. It should also be noted that a large number of the jobs generated by the industry are highly qualified. The structural analysis of the developers and turbine manufacturers staff shows that the percentage of university graduates is high: 55% in the case of wind farm developers and 49% in the case of wind turbine manufacturers. The growing interest in obtaining training related to wind energy in our country, as the analysis of the large number of courses and students shows, is proof of the importance of this employment. These, among other factors, have allowed the Spanish wind power sector companies to undertake international expansion, which makes this sector a re-

ference in the world, not only for the leadership of its major businesses but also because of the massive presence of small and medium companies all over the world where they take their experience, know-how and technology. One of the five major wind turbine manufacturers and two of the top five wind energy operators in the world are Spanish and the sector exported in 2009 worth 2,179 million Euros, more than other traditional sectors in our country such as fishing, leather and footwear. Company Presentation Alstom is a global leader in the world of power generation, power transmission and rail infrastructure and sets the benchmark for innovative and environmentally friendly technologies. Alstom builds the fastest train and the highest capacity automated metro in the world, provides turnkey integrated power plant solutions and associated services for a wide variety of energy sources, including hydro, nuclear, gas, coal and wind, and it offers a wide range of solutions for power transmission, with a focus on smart grids. The Group employs 95,000 people in more than 70 countries, and had sales of over 23 billion* in 2009/10. *Pro forma figures. Alstom offers integral wind farm solutions, covering site development activities, system or key component design and manufacturing, assembly, installation, and O&M services for a wide range of onshore wind turbines spanning 1.67 MW to 3 MW. Through Alstoms two wind turbine platforms ECO 80 and ECO 100, the company proposes the appropriate choice of wind turbine to match different wind farm locations and wind speeds. All Alstoms wind products feature the companys ALSTOM PURE TORQUE concept, a unique mechanical design concept which protects the gearbox and other drive train components from deflection loads. Alstom has installed or is installing over 1850 wind turbines in over 100 wind farms, corresponding to a total capacity of over 2200 MW.

Company Presentation Founded in 1970, ANSYS employs over 1,600 employees, and many of them are engineers with advanced degrees and extensive training in fields such as finite element analysis, computational fluid dynamics and design optimization. ANSYS is passionate about pushing the limits of its world-class technology, so our customers can turn their design concepts into successful, innovative products. Engineering simulation software from ANSYS provides an integrated environment designed to solve the fundamental mathematical equations related to structural mechanics, fluid mechanics, thermal science, vibration analysis, electromagnetic studies and acoustics science. The technology also analyzes the interdependency of underlying physics in multiphysics simulations, especially critical for wind energy engineers since turbines often include all aspects of fluid, structural and electrical design. Business lines Wind energy engineers use ANSYS solutions to develop ongoing technology innovations across the wind energy supply chain in both small and large wind projects. The software helps organizations to develop, manufacture, transport and install wind turbines no matter the goal, including reduced cost, improved wind turbine reliability, and operating efficiency. Engineering simulation software from ANSYS addresses the full range of engineering challenges involved in wind energy systems, including these specific applications: Aerodynamic design (thrust coefficients, blade structural integrity, ultimate loads and fatigue, noise prediction, wind gusts, fluidstructure interaction, bird strikes, icing, boundary layer transition, near wake and far field studies) Structural design (tower and rotor structural integrity/safety, power conversion efficiency, installation and maintenance, offshore transport and installation)

Component design (blades, gearboxes and bearings, generator, nacelles, rotors, yaw drives, yaw motors) Site selection and farm layout (maximum project potential, peak and average power outputs, wind loads, fatigue rates, logistics) Turbine placement (variable terrain, rough terrain, forestry issues, multiple wake effects, building and setbacks) Electromechanical systems (electrical machines, variable-speed control systems, transformers, power electronics, power distribution systems, sensor and actuator design) Manufacturing processes (composites engineering)

The focus on innovation continues today, with the smart pitch system that increases turbine efficiency or the compact differential-type gearboxes that contribute significantly to reducing the tower head weight of multi-megawatt wind turbines. The drive system determines efficiency and reliability of a wind turbine. Rexroth offers a wide range of drive solutions applicable to all types of wind turbines. MOBILEX GFB precision yaw drives ensure accurate orientation with the wind and turn the nacelle slowly to face the wind once the cut-in wind speed is reached. For rotor blade adjustment, Rexroth provides complete electromechanical or hydraulic pitch drives. As the core component of a wind turbine drive train, REDULUS GPV gearboxes step up the slow speed of the rotor shaft into the high speed of the generator shaft. As a world leader in industrial hydraulics, Rexroth offers a multitude of hydraulic solutions for wind turbines: Our standard program range includes modular power units and controls for main drive train and yaw drive braking systems. Reliable wind turbine operation requires condition monitoring systems. The BLADEcontrol rotor blade monitoring system and a gearbox oil monitoring system complete the Rexroth product offering for wind turbines. Company Presentation Bosch Rexroth, member of Bosch Group, is one of the leading specialists worldwide in drive and control technology. Under the brand name Rexroth, the company supplies tailored solutions for driving, controlling and moving. Bosch Rexroth is a partner for industrial applications and factory automation, mobile applications and using renewable energies. The Drive & Control Company is the supplier of choice to more than 500,000 customers for high quality electrical, hydraulic, pneumatic and mechatronic components and systems in more than 80 countries. For almost a century, Rexroth has been developing and producing innovative drive system components, and was involved in the development of early wind turbine drive systems. The gearboxes for the 3.2 MW AEOLUS II wind turbines were developed in the early 90s a true pioneering achievement in the wind energy industry.
